| | 2. |  | Rosencrantz and Guildenstern Are Dead from Faber & Faber Price: $10.05
Customer Review:
 Tom Stoppard argues quite persuasively in this play against notions of meaning, truth, and reality. In the form of a narrative, Stoppard seeks to destroy the idea of a narrative. The play is the perspective of two minor characters in Hamlet, tossed about by the whims of monarchs, princes, and an... more info
